The best shoes for the first steps

Well, now, let's see what the baby's first shoes should be:

  1. Comfortable.
  2. The selected pair must be made of natural materials. Including the insole and the entire inner surface.
  3. Have a fixed, sufficiently firm, deformable backdrop.
  4. Also in stock should be heels, wide - somewhere up to half a foot, not high - 0.5mm.
  5. From the heel to the back, a small spade is desirable, approximately so that you can shove the tip of the index finger into it.
  6. Have a soft, non-slip sole (ideally - when bending up a shoe or sandal, the socks should reach the back).

In such shoes, the baby's first steps will be right and easy.

In addition to the "right" shoes, the characteristics of which are listed in the list given above, there are also orthopedic shoes. It treats and prevents various leg diseases. It differs from the usual high clasps (above the ankles) and a very tight back.

To buy such footwear without recommendations of the doctor-orthopedist it is not necessary. If you really want, you can buy preventive models of orthopedic shoes. Or there are orthopedic insoles for sale, they can be made individually for your child or you can buy standard ones. Insoles are better to invest in orthopedic shoes, because such an insole should fit snugly to the leg, and ordinary footwear is wider than the medical one.

When to buy and wear the first child's shoes?

Some orthopedists recommend wearing booties from six months until the moment when the child starts walking without support. Argumented by fixation of the ankle joint. But this is a contradictory theory.

Given the choice of the right and comfortable shoes to make the first steps the child will be easier. Up to 10-12 months you can stomp in rag-like slippers. To develop an ankle joint, doctors recommend walking barefoot on uneven surfaces - grass, sand, pebbles, etc.

When the child only begins to stand on the legs, you can put on booties with a fixing sole - pimply, corrugated, etc.

What first shoes to buy a baby?

About what should be the first shoes, you will be told in detail by an orthopedist. A surgeon or neurologist on a routine examination may reveal some abnormalities in the development and formation of the foot.

When buying the first shoe, take the baby with you to the store. Measure both shoes or sandals. Walk for about five minutes, and follow the reaction of the child. The first winter footwear, as well as the spring autumn and summer, should be comfortable. Pay attention to the toe of the boot, it should be wide enough for free movement of the fingers in warm socks or pantyhose. Never buy the first shoes for growth, the maximum distance from the toe is 0.5cm.

Most likely, orthopedic shoes for the first steps you will not come in handy. The first orthopedic footwear may be needed not earlier than three years. After all, it is precisely up to this age that it is almost impossible to say exactly about the presence of flat feet and its varieties. But, if the changes are very clear, then the doctor's recommendations will help to correct the leg. In addition to the necessary footwear, there are also therapeutic massages.
